About the Role

The Tactical Sourcing Specialist – Logistics is responsible for executing sourcing initiatives, rate analysis, and supplier performance management for transportation and warehousing services supporting a company within the Food & Beverage Ingredients industry, with a strong focus on Taste & Nutrition solutions distribution network focused in the United States.

This role combines strong analytical capability with hands-on sourcing execution, ensuring competitive rates, accurate cost modeling, capacity continuity, and operational responsiveness in a fast-paced industrial distribution environment.

The position works closely with US-based strategic sourcing, logistics operations, finance, and distribution teams.

 

Key Responsibilities:

  • Execute RFQs, spot bids, mini-tenders, and rate events for:
    • FTL and LTL transportation
    • Parcel and regional carriers
    • Intermodal (where applicable)
    • Ambient and overflow warehousing services
  • Support contract renewals and pricing updates in line with approved category strategies.
  • Assist in onboarding new carriers and warehouse providers.
  • Cleanse, transform, and structure large datasets to support sourcing decisions.
  • Build and conduct sourcing events (RFx) including e-Auctions.
  • Build and maintain detailed cost models for transportation and warehousing (fuel, accessorials, labor, capacity, lane density).
  • Perform total cost of ownership (TCO) analysis across lanes, carriers, and warehouse options.
  • Analyze freight spend, rate cards, contract compliance, and savings performance.
  • Identify cost anomalies, margin leakage, and optimization opportunities.
  • Develop dashboards and reports to track savings vs target, service performance, and rate trends.
  • Support budgeting and forecasting processes with data-backed insights.
  • Support the development and execution of comprehensive transport and warehousing, focusing on optimization, integrating sustainable solutions.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to understand their logistics needs, ensuring alignment with broader business objectives and drive project implementation.
  • Analyze market trends and supplier performance to ensure competitive pricing, quality, and reliability.
  • Identify and implement cost-saving initiatives and process improvements.
  • Engage with new and existing suppliers to negotiate contracts that align with our goals.
  • Manage supplier relationships, ensuring compliance, performance, and goals for continuous improvement.
